Fig. 3: Spatially resolved functionalization of SWCNT thin films.

a Schematic illustration of the functionalization procedure using UV-light (λex = 365 nm) and a shadow mask, which is placed on top of a spin-coated nanotube network (polymer-wrapped (6,5) SWCNTs) on BCB-coated glass or silicon substrates. Irradiation through an aqueous AQS solution (2 mg mL−1) in contact with the nanotube film leads to the formation of luminescent defects in the exposed areas. b AFM image of SWCNT network used for functionalization (scale bar, 1 µm). c Map of integrated Raman D/G+ ratios at the shadow mask edge (solid black line) after functionalization. d, e Averaged, normalized PL spectra (>100 averaged spectra) of masked and exposed areas after functionalization.
